    Advice: Form good study skills from the start. Come to class. Read the text and do the homework. Do not fall behind. It is often hard to catch up in a math class after falling behind. If you are having trouble, then seek help without delay. Find classmates to study with. Go to office hours. Talk to me before or after class.
